    El bate de funjo profesional de arce para béisbol/sóftbol Mizuno de 37" 340626 es un bate de funjo híbrido versátil y de nivel profesional diseñado tanto para ejercicios de cuadro interior como de cuadro exterior. Fabricado con arce duradero y con un núcleo de álamo ligero, este bate de funjo ofrece una excelente sensación y control, lo que lo convierte en la herramienta perfecta para los entrenadores. Su diseño ligero permite un fácil manejo, mientras que el acabado de alto brillo ofrece una apariencia profesional y de primera calidad. Ya sea que esté trabajando en la precisión del cuadro interior o en la exactitud del cuadro exterior, este bate de funjo está diseñado para ayudarlo a ejecutar los ejercicios de práctica con facilidad.

    Características principales:

    Construcción de madera de alta calidad: Proporciona durabilidad y un rendimiento fiable.
    Diseño de funjo ligero: Permite swings más rápidos, mejorando el tiempo y la reacción durante la práctica.
    Forma de barril extendida: Aumenta la superficie para un mejor control del contacto y colocación de la pelota.
    Distribución de peso equilibrada: Mejora la precisión al golpear líneas o elevados.
    Acabado suave del mango: Asegura un agarre cómodo para reducir la fatiga de la mano durante las largas sesiones de entrenamiento.

     

    El bate de funjo profesional de arce para béisbol/sóftbol Mizuno de 37" 340626 ofrece control, equilibrio y durabilidad de nivel profesional para el entrenamiento diario.

  • Pitch-back screen work is the most efficient solo fielding drill for infielders. Throw the ball into the screen at three-quarter speed, field the return with proper footwork, and simulate the throw to first in sequence. Varying the target zone on the screen produces different return angles that simulate grounders to the backhand, short hops, and routine grounders to the glove side.

  • Most youth baseball organizations do not require fielder face masks. Some youth softball organizations require masks for all infield positions at certain age levels. Pitchers in fastpitch softball at youth and high school levels are the most common position where masks are strongly recommended and increasingly required by state associations. Check your specific league's rules.

  • A training glove is a smaller-than-regulation glove that creates a tighter pocket, forcing the player to field the ball precisely in the center. They are most effective for infielders who want to develop better glove control and reduce the habit of catching the ball in the palm or heel of a standard glove.   • Yes. Most pitch-back screens include ground stakes or weighted feet for stability on both grass and dirt surfaces. On soft ground, use the included stakes. On harder surfaces, rubber foot pads or sandbags prevent sliding without damaging the playing surface.

  • Pitch-back screens are appropriate starting around age 8 to 10, when players have enough arm strength and coordination to benefit from the rebound. Fielder masks can be used at any age where a player wears a batting helmet. Training gloves are most effective for players age 12 and older with developed fielding mechanics.

  • Yes. Pitchers use pitch-back screens to practice delivery mechanics, work on follow-through position, and take fielding reps off the mound. The screen also serves as a catcher substitute for tracking pitch location when a zone target is printed on the net.

  • The terms are often used interchangeably. A pitch-back screen typically refers to a flat or angled net on a freestanding frame that returns thrown balls. A fielding rebounder may have an adjustable rebounding angle that produces returns at different heights. Both serve the same fundamental purpose.

  • Inspect the net for fraying or holes after each heavy use session. Tighten loose bungee cords or net lacing. Store the screen folded flat in a dry location when not in use. Leaving a screen outside through a full winter season shortens the life of both the net material and plastic frame components. Steel frames should be wiped down to prevent rust at pivot points.

  • Yes. The screen creates the reps without requiring the parent to deliver the ball with precision. The player throws the ball in and fields the return, which is self-directed. A parent can add value by observing footwork and glove position, but no coaching expertise is required for the screen itself to produce useful fielding reps.

  • A productive session is typically 100 to 200 quality fielding reps in 20 to 30 minutes. Quality means completing the footwork, glove work, and transfer sequence on every rep. Rest between sets of 20 to 30 reps, particularly for younger players developing arm strength.

  • Most steel-frame pitch-back screens fold flat and weigh 15 to 25 pounds. They fit in a full-size vehicle without folding the seats down and set up in under five minutes. They are portable enough for players who want to set up a fielding station at a local park or school field before or after team practice.

  • Fielder masks use coated steel wire in a grid pattern, similar to catcher face masks but lighter and designed for attachment to a batting helmet. Padding around the edges and a foam forehead pad add comfort at the helmet rail attachment points.

  • Yes, primarily for developing throwing mechanics, footwork on charge drills, and reaction time. Outfielders can set the screen at a longer distance and practice fielding low-hop returns that simulate balls hit in the gap. For fly-ball tracking, a partner or coach with a fungo delivers more realistic reps than a screen can replicate.
